when you cleaned that little tube, did you clean the sensor too? the sensor could be dirty as well throwing the code. or the sensor could be going out. i think that sensor is relatively cheap, somewhere around $30.00. but it's good to hear that it helped. i know when you're towing even 1 mpg better is awesome. as far as the code soming back, try cleaning or replacing the sensor. to clean it, use a small pic and some brakeclean.
